Just a side note: Antidotes are sometimes (not often) also poisonous if taken without the poison. That means if you are not sure if you have been poisoned by this exact poison and still take it, you are risking worsening your case. That's why medical staff have to be really sure about the substance people get poisend with before giving any antidotes

For everyone that is like "omg why didnt he use the antidote" let me share a few things about this "antidote". For starters, the toxin in question is known as an irreversible acetylcholinesterase inhibitor. Acetylcholinesterase job is to break down acetylcholine. A common neurotransmitter (signaling chemical) in your body that mainly regulated the "rest and digest" part of your nervous system. So when you get a toxin like VX , its going to stop the breakdown of Acetylcholine leading to increased levels in the body causing excess "rest and digest" mode. This will lead to symptoms like low heart rate, shortness of breath, too much salivation, and your nervous system getting really excited which can cause stuff like confusion , seizure, becoming psychotic. Now. This man would not be able to 100% know for himself, even if he was instructed on what symptoms to lookout for, on whether or not he was being poisoned with this particular toxin. But lets say he took the chance and gave himself the antidote (atropine). For one. Thats not even the full antidote. He still needs the second part of the antidote pralidoxime as atropine has its limitations. Secondly, what IF he gave himself the Atropine and he didnt actually have this particular toxicity? He just gave himself the atropine and that comes with its own set of side effects. It would potentially send his body in rapid "flight or fight" response and spike up his heart rate and shortness of breath and confusion. He could even die if the dose is high enough. So yah. Just wanted to provide a little insight on the mechanics of this drug. Also, fun fact for you all. There is a less potent toxin of the same mechanism that farmers get exposed to and present similarly to this man. Same treatment for them too. Atropine!

Many North Korean defectors have come out to say that watching South Korean entertainment is very common amongst teenagers there and not something you would get killed over. The punishment for murder on the other hand is known to be a death sentence.
